If you had to pick three qualities that are most important to develop, which three would you say matter most?
Three things that have been most impactful are:
1. – Having a genuine passion for the art of cheese-making and charcuterie has been crucial. This passion not only fuels my creativity but also sustains me through the challenges of running a business. My advice is to explore and identify what truly excites and motivates you in your chosen field. Let your passion be the driving force behind your efforts and decisions.
2.- The business landscape can be unpredictable, and being adaptable and resilient is key. Flexibility in responding to market trends, unexpected challenges, and customer preferences has been essential. To develop this skill, embrace change as an opportunity for growth rather than a setback. Stay informed about industry trends, be open to learning, and cultivate a mindset that sees challenges as stepping stones toward success.
3.- Building relationships within the local community and networking with fellow businesses, suppliers, and customers has been instrumental in the success of my business. Establishing a strong network not only opens up opportunities but also provides invaluable support. Early in your journey, actively seek opportunities to connect with others in your industry. Attend events, join local business associations, and engage with your community. Building a network will not only enhance your business connections but also offer a support system when needed.

Before we go, any advice you can share with people who are feeling overwhelmed?
While I certainly don’t have it entirely dialed in yet, these are the few strategies I found helpful to regain focus and maintain balance: – Prioritize tasks- breaking down what feels overwhelming and identify the most critical tasks that need immediate attention
-Recognize that you don’t have to do everything on your own and delegate tasks to capable team members or seek support from others.
-Incorporate mindfulness techniques into your routine, such as meditation or mindful breathing. These practices can help you stay present, reduce stress, and enhance your ability to navigate challenges
-Regularly assess your work-life balance and make adjustments if needed. Balancing work and personal life is crucial for long-term well-being and sustainability.
